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• 5+ years Delta Controls experience
  • GCL programming proficiency required
  • Low voltage electrical troubleshooting
  • HVAC hydronics and air systems knowledge
  • Conduit bending and installation skills

Nice-to-have

  • Strong mathematical problem-solving sk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ication
  • Ability to work flexible shifts including nights
  • Experience training others on system operations

Key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Valid Florida Driver's License
  • Forklift and man-lift certification within 90 days
  • Minimum 5 years relevant industry experience
